Biography
Kwon Mina (권민아), born September 21, 1993, in Busan, South Korea, is a former K-pop idol, actress, and singer best known as a member of the popular girl group AOA (Ace of Angels).

Public Allegations and Hiatus
In 2020, Mina made public allegations regarding prolonged bullying during her time as a member of AOA. Her statements drew considerable public attention and prompted widespread discussion concerning interpersonal relationships within idol groups, agency management, and mental health issues in the entertainment industry.
Following these events, Mina openly shared her struggles with mental health and gradually withdrew from public activities. Her case became a focal point in broader conversations about artist welfare and the pressures faced by K-pop idols.

Fun Facts
-
Kwon Mina’s immediate family consists of her mother and an older sister.
-
She was accepted into FNC Entertainment through an audition in 2009.
-
Prior to her debut, she was known as a popular ulzzang (internet visual figure).
-
During her time in AOA, her official “angel name” was Minaring.
-
Her father passed away in 2014, after which she temporarily suspended group activities.
-
Mina worked as an MC for Y-STAR’s Gourmet Road and served as a co-MC on MBC Every1’s Weekly Idol.
-
Mina left AOA and FNC Entertainment in 2019 upon the expiration of her contract. She was signed to O& Entertainment from 2019 to 2020.
